js try用法
    JavaScript(JavaScript)是一种广泛使用的编程语言,用于网页开发、服务器端编程和应用程序开发。它具有易学、易用和功能丰富等特点,成为了前端开发的必备语言之一。在JavaScript中,try-catch使用是非常重要的一部分,因此下面将详细讲解其使用方法。
    try语句块主要用于测试代码,catch语句块用于处理抛出的异常,finally语句块表示无论是否抛出异常都会执行的代码块。下面分别介绍它们的用法。
    1、try语句块
    try语句块是包裹可能出现异常的代码的语句块。其语法格式如下:
    try {
  // 可能出现异常的代码
}
    try语句块中的代码如果出现异常,将会被捕获并交给catch语句块进行处理。如果try语句块中的代码没有出现异常,将会直接跳过catch语句块。
    2、catch语句块
    catch语句块用于处理try语句块中的异常。其语法格式如下:
    try {
  // 可能出现异常的代码
} catch(e) {try catch的使用方法
  // 处理异常的代码
}
    catch语句块中,括号内的e表示异常对象,通过这个对象可以获取异常的相关信息。在该语句块中,我们可以进行异常的处理和记录。如果有多个异常需要处理,可以在try语句
块后面直接添加多个catch语句块,并且catch语句块中的逻辑按顺序执行,会执行第一个匹配异常类型的代码块。
    3、finally语句块
    无论try块中的代码是否发生异常,finally语句块都将被执行。其语法格式如下:
    try {
    // 可能出现异常的代码
} catch(e) {
  // 处理异常的代码
} finally {
  //无论是否发生异常,finally代码块都会执行
}
    finally语句块主要用于资源的清理和释放,比如关闭文件、释放内存等。在执行try-catch-finally语句块的过程中,finally语句块的执行优先级高于其他语句块。
    总结:
    try-catch-finally语句块是JavaScript异常处理的核心部分。通过try语句块,我们可以到可能出现错误的代码段,catch语句块用于处理这些异常,finally语句块则负责执行无论是否发生异常都需要处理的代码。这个语句块的使用可以有效地避免程序运行过程中出现异常而导致程序崩溃,同时也可以更好地保护用户数据的安全。

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。